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Azure DevOps
- Free tier is capped at 5 users and 1,800 monthly minutes on a single Microsoft-hosted pipeline job; extra parallel jobs cost $40/month each beyond that allocation, per azure.microsoft.com, August 2026
Together AI
- Fine tuning carries a minimum charge of $4.00 per job regardless of dataset size
- Reserved GPU commitments beyond 180 days are priced by contacting sales with no published rate
- Volume and enterprise discounts are quote only with no published threshold
- Reserved dedicated inference pricing is contact sales while only on demand rates of $5.49 to $8.99 per GPU hour are published
